What Does "are you ready for what could come next" Mean?

Learn what "are you ready for what could come next" means, when people say it, and how to use it naturally in English.

Luca, we've crossed the line. Are you ready for what could come next?

This asks if someone is mentally prepared for the next stage or consequence.

From In Love With My Godfather's Daughter, Episode 11

When do people say this?

Scene Context

Someone asks whether another person is prepared for what may happen next.

Usage Scenario

Use it to warn or challenge someone before a tense development. It can sound dramatic or threatening depending on context.
